diff --git a/apps/app/src/app/(app)/[orgId]/documents/components/CompanySubmissionWizard.account-types.test.tsx b/apps/app/src/app/(app)/[orgId]/documents/components/CompanySubmissionWizard.account-types.test.tsx new file mode 100644 index 0000000000..cc4c13044c --- /dev/null +++ b/apps/app/src/app/(app)/[orgId]/documents/components/CompanySubmissionWizard.account-types.test.tsx @@ -0,0 +1,66 @@ +import { fireEvent, render, screen, waitFor, within } from '@testing-library/react'; +import { describe, expect, it, vi } from 'vitest'; + +vi.mock('next/navigation', () => ({ + useRouter: () => ({ push: vi.fn(), refresh: vi.fn() }), +})); +vi.mock('@/lib/api-client', () => ({ api: { post: vi.fn() } })); +vi.mock('@/components/file-uploader', () => ({ FileUploader: () =>
})); +vi.mock('sonner', () => ({ toast: { success: vi.fn(), error: vi.fn() } })); + +// Light design-system mock: render a Select as a native , + Section: Passthrough, + Text: ({ children }: any) => {children}, + Textarea: (props: any) =>